中文摘要

目標:本研究主要目的是發展“SAFE”教育方案並評估對居家護理個案用藥安全之成
效。方法:採單組前後測類實驗設計,立意取樣南部某醫院附設居家護理所34位個案與其主
要照顧者為研究對象,接受團隊研擬“SAFE”教育方案,包括標準化安全用藥衛生教育流程
(Standardizing health education about safe medication administration; S)、評估用藥適當性(Assessing
medication adequacy ; A)、促進一個用藥安全的環境(Facilitating a safety medication environment;
F)與評值是否執行安全用藥(Evaluating whether practicing safety medication; E)等四項過程,每個
月一次,為期三個月。並在教育方案介入前與介入完成後一個月,分別進行前測及後測評量。
結果:34位個案用藥安全問題於衛生教育前件數7件,經介入完成後一個月降至1件,McNemar
檢定達顯著下降(X2
=4.17, p<0.05)。介入完成後一個月,主要照顧者的用藥安全認知由介入前
的6.7分提升至8.4分,成對樣本檢定達顯著上升(t= -5.5, p<0.01)。結論:“SAFE”教育方案確實
顯著降低居家護理個案的用藥安全問題,並有助於主要照顧者對個案用藥安全認知程度之提
升,其可作為居家護理實務的參考。(台灣衛誌 2012;31(5):473-484)

英文摘要

Objectives: The purpose of this article was to examine the effect of the “SAFE” education
protocol on improving safe medication administration for home healthcare clients. Methods:
We used a quasi-experimental design and subjects were a convenience sample of thirty-four
home healthcare clients recruited from a homecare center in a hospital in southern Taiwan. The
group received the “SAFE” education protocol, including Standardizing health education about
safe medication administration, Assessing medication adequacy, Facilitating a safe medication
environment, and Evaluating medication safety (acronym: SAFE). The program was held
once a month, for 3 months. The outcomes were measured before intervention and 1 month
post-intervention. Results: The results showed an average of 7 medication problems in home
healthcare clients before intervention and one, 1 month post-intervention (X2
=4.17, p<0.05). The
scores for perception of medication safety by caregivers increased from 6.7 before intervention
to 8.4 at 1 month post-intervention(t= -5.5, p<0.01). Conclusions: The “SAFE” education
protocol may effectively decrease the medication problems experienced by home healthcare
clients and increase the perception of medication safety by caregivers. . (Taiwan J Public Health.
2012;31(5):473-484)
